Position Summary:
The Program Manager will play a critical role in driving execution of the companys most important strategic priorities. This role sits within the Strategy Execution Office (SEO) and will operate in two capacities:
(1) Program Manager: Primarily you will drive the day-to-day planning and execution of one of our Top 12 strategic priorities (or a major workstream within one) coordinating across functions ensuring milestones are achieved and delivering measurable business outcomes.
(2) Portfolio Support Role: In addition to leading a specific initiative you will contribute to the overall health and effectiveness of the strategy execution portfolio. This includes helping manage cross-initiative dependencies supporting enterprise-level risk and issue management driving portfolio reporting and analytics and contributing to the continuous improvement of our operating rhythm.
This role requires strong program management discipline cross-functional coordination skills and the ability to operate in a dynamic fast-moving environment. You will work closely with initiative owners and functional leaders to ensure our most critical programs stay on track deliver value and remain tightly aligned to our strategy.
*This person must be able to commute to our San Diego HQ 2-3 days/week.

Responsibilities:
Initiative Leadership
Partner with initiative owners and stakeholders to define plan and execute strategic programs that align with enterprise goals
Develop and maintain program scope timelines resource plans and milestone tracking ensuring alignment across functional and regional teams
Lead the initiatives execution rhythm including workplans stakeholder engagement/communication and dependency management
Facilitate business case development and ensure clear articulation of expected value and outcomes
Identify and escalate key risks issues and decisions and support resolution in partnership with initiative leads and the SEO
Portfolio-Level Execution Support
Support the overall portfolio by helping drive cross-initiative visibility into dependencies risks capability gaps and resource bottlenecks
Assist in maintaining a consistent program management framework including use of lifecycle gates execution standards and governance routines
Contribute to portfolio reporting scorecards and KPI tracking synthesizing initiative-level progress into executive-level insights
Collaborate with other program managers and the SEO to drive continuous improvement in our execution model tools and ways of working

Requirements:
BA / BS (science business math or econ/finance preferred)
8 years of professional experience in program & project management business transformation process improvement change management system implementation and/or similar corporate functions
3 years in cross-functional roles within a global enterprise
PMP certification preferred
Advanced analytical and presentation skills
Experience building financial business cases
Ability to engage and influence effectively at all levels and within a matrixed environment
Ability to collaborate and communicate effectively with a diverse set of peers and stakeholders across organizational levels functions and geographies/cultures
Must be driven self-motivated well-organized and able to thrive under ambiguity
